The Golden State Warriors may remain motionless when it comes to free agency as Jonathan Kuminga's situation continues to play out, but at the very least there is some movement in regard to their G League roster ahead of the upcoming season.
Yuri Collins has spent the past two years with the Warriors in the G League and was elevated onto a 10-day contract late last season, yet his time with the franchise now appears to be over after his G League rights were traded to the Long Island Nets on Tuesday.
